DIRECTORATE: Infrastructure, Planning & Environment CLASSIFICATION: Grade H SALARY: A base salary of $97,623 pa with competency-based increments up to $113,243 pa 12% employer contribution to superannuation REPORTING TO: Senior Building Surveyor EMPLOYMENT TYPE: Permanent Full Time THE POSITION: This position will actively support the Senior Building Surveyors to provide a customer focused and responsive Building Surveying service to the community. The jobholder will undertake delegated Building Surveying regulatory functions and duties associated with buildings & structures (all classes under the National; Construction Code), development approvals, swimming pools and fire safety assessment, approvals and inspections. Responsibilities KEY RESPONSIBILITIES: Exercise the role of Certifying Authority and Principal Certifying Authority on behalf of Council under the provisions of the associated legislation Assess and determine applications for Part 6 Building and Subdivision Certification Applications. Carry out critical stage inspections of buildings and structures. Review and approve correspondence and applications Assess and determine Development Applications for dwelling houses and ancillary structures. Prepare conditions of Development Consent – referrals Process section 68 applications such as Solid Fuel Heater, Building Information Certificates, stormwater, OSSM and plumbing approvals. Undertake inspections of section 68 approvals Facilitate the Fire safety inspection program and provide a follow up service with regard to “Annual Fire Safety Statements”. Undertake inspections for Council’s Swimming Pool Inspection Program. Provide general customer support services. Undertake general administrative duties and functions, including the NSW Planning Portal. Maintain building, swimming pool, plumbing and other data bases as required. Perform other tasks or duties as directed by the Senior Building Surveyor & Team Leader which are within the limits of the employee’s skill, competence and training. Observe requirements of the WHS Legislation, relevant to the job and adhere to AlburyCity Policies and Procedures regarding WHS. Observe appropriate AlburyCity Policies and Procedures regarding day to day operations including Equal Employment Opportunity policies, AlburyCity’s Dress Code and Standards Policy and AlburyCity’s Code of Conduct. ESSENTIAL CRITERIA: Degree or Advanced Diploma in Building Surveying or related discipline and/or relevant demonstrated Building Surveying experience Accredited as a Registered Certifier - Building Surveyor-Unrestricted/ Restricted by the NSW Department of Fair Trading Extensive knowledge of the National Construction Code and associated standards Extensive customer service skills Class C (standard) Driver's Licence (compulsory to have and maintain) DESIRABLE CRITERIA: White card - Construction Knowledge of NSW Local Government practices SPECIALIST KNOWLEDGE AND SKILLS: A thorough understanding of relevant legislation, requirements and obligations regarding Development Assessment and Certification related elements. High level understanding of; Environmental Planning & Assessment Act Local Government Act Building Regulations (NCC) Building and Development Certifiers Act, fire safety principles and fire safety program implementation Plumbing and Drainage Act and associated plumbing standards Computer literacy and ability to learn new systems/processes as required An advanced understanding of word processing, general office equipment and general office functions.
